Gentle pressure: Braces simply apply a gentle pressure to the teeth. The teeth respond by slowly moving in the direction of the pressure. Typically, we can use elastics, rubberbands, or wire springs to apply the pressure. Invisalign uses clear plastic trays for the pressure.

Elastic chains: We use elastic chains from tooth to tooth it is stretched between the teeth and as it contracts over time it brings the teeth together.

Orthodontics: Orthodontics is a science of using subtle forces to move teeth to create a beautiful and healthy smile and bite. These forces can rotate crooked teeth and adjust your bite to correct your bite. These forces are used to close spaces between teeth as well.

Force: The "medicine" we use in Orthodontics is light continuous force which remodels the bone around teeth. If your teeth and supporting gums/bone are healthy, your teeth are appropriately sized, and your jaws match each other, Orthodontic treatment may work extremely well for you.
